#897010 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#897010 is composed of 53.7% red, 43.9%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.2% magenta, 88.3%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 47.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 30%. #897010 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e020 with #130000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#897010 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#897010 has RGB values of R:137, G:112,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.88,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 9007120.

Shades and Tints of #897010
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0b02 is the darkest color, while #fffef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#897010
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4d4b is the less saturated color, while #957704 is the most saturated one.
